Search is changing fast. Today's shoppers aren't just
scanning standard blue links; they are asking AI models and conversational
assistants for instant product recommendations. This is where Generative Engine
Optimization (GEO) comes in.
While traditional Search Engine Optimization focuses on
getting your pages to rank on search engine results pages (SERPs), GEO
optimizes your brand content so AI engines (like ChatGPT, Gemini, Perplexity,
and Google AI Overviews) cite and recommend your products directly.

Generative Engine Optimization (GEO) is the process of
structuring your store’s content so AI search tools cite and recommend your
products when users ask conversational questions. As more shoppers use AI
assistants to find gifts, compare products, and read reviews, GEO ensures your
brand is recommended directly inside those AI answers.
While paid ads deliver instant traffic, organic search
strategies typically start showing noticeable growth within 3 to 6 months.
Consistency in technical updates, fresh content creation, and GEO practices
yields long-term, compounding results that reduce your customer acquisition
costs over time.
